As the days get longer and the weather warms up, it is time to think about giving our wood-burning stoves a bit of a spring clean. It is important to make sure your stove is working well and safe all year round.

1. Give it a Good Clean:
Over the winter, your stove can build up soot and creosote, which can make it less efficient and even dangerous. Start by giving the inside of your stove a clean with a wire brush or stove cleaner to get rid of any dirt and grime. Then, wipe down the outside with a damp cloth to get rid of any dust. Make sure to check the door seals and hinges too.
2. Check the Chimney and Flue:
Before you start using your stove regularly again, it is a good idea to check the chimney and flue for any damage or blockages. Use a torch to check for any build-up of soot or debris, and if you need to, get a professional chimney sweep in to give it a proper clean. Take a look at the flue pipe as well to make sure it is in good condition.
3. Inspect the Door Seal:
The door seal is important for making sure your stove burns efficiently. Check it for any signs of wear or damage, like fraying or flattening. If it is looking worn out, you might need to replace it to keep your stove working well.
4. Check the Fire Bricks:
The fire bricks inside your stove protect it from heat damage. Take a look to see if any of them are cracked or damaged, and if they are, it's a good idea to replace them. Good fire bricks help your stove retain heat and work better.
5. Check the Air Vents and Controls:
Make sure the air vents and controls on your stove are clean and working properly. They control how much air gets into the stove, which affects how hot the fire burns. Clean out any dust or dirt from the air vents, and make sure the controls move smoothly.
